摘要
Fuel moisture monitoring is an important component of fire danger rating system in fire management. This paper describes the application of NDVI images in monitoring potential fire danger and analyses the relationship between MODIS-NDVI and fire weather index. The series of weather data in Beijing are used in this analysis including fire seasons in spring during 2004 to 2005. Canadian Fire Weather Index (FWI) is selected in this study, because it can properly estimate moisture conditions of live fuel. Fine fuel moisture, drought code and FWI values are generated by using the squared inverse distance algorithm. Strong correlations have previously been observed between FWI variables and NDVI data. The MODIS-NDVI images can be used in fire management as component related with live fuel moisture and fire danger.
